First, plainly: what happened to LinkedIn in Russia

Many people's real experience is: the LinkedIn website won't open, the app was pulled from the Russian stores long ago, messages won't load. This isn't your phone. In November 2016, Russia's regulator RKN formally blocked LinkedIn under the personal-data-localization law (which requires Russian citizens' personal data to be stored on servers inside Russia) — LinkedIn refused to move its data into Russia and became the first major Western platform blocked wholesale in Russia. So the situation is straightforward: in Russia, LinkedIn no longer connects by default, and you need a channel that bypasses the block to reach the website and app normally.

Why free VPN extensions / proxies often aren't stable enough

Facing a block, many people first install a free VPN browser extension or find a free proxy. It holds up for a while, but in Russia the reality is: first, free extensions / proxies use public shared IP ranges that are easy to block wholesale — hence "works today, gone in a couple of days"; second, a plain proxy just forwards traffic with no handshake camouflage, so under ever-upgrading DPI it's easy to detect and throttle; third, a browser extension only protects the browser, while your LinkedIn mobile app and other apps still run over the real network; fourth, on privacy, a free extension can see all the traffic in your browser — especially sensitive for LinkedIn, which you run under your real name and real network — with a track record of logging / reselling.

The more reliable alternative: a VLESS + Reality client

VLESS is a lean transport protocol, and Reality is its TLS camouflage layer, disguising your traffic as ordinary HTTPS to a real public website. Running VLESS+Reality with a real client (sing-box / v2rayN / Shadowrocket) is system-level: LinkedIn's website and app, Facebook, Instagram, and the browser all go through the tunnel; a dedicated node is more stable and harder to block wholesale; and compared with a free proxy whose entry points are public, it's harder for DPI to auto-fingerprint. The cost is that you need a subscription and a client. To be honest too: no solution guarantees it always works — exit-IP reputation, SNI, and keys still matter; and during a regional blackout no cross-border channel connects, so LinkedIn won't either.

Is it safe to sign in to LinkedIn from a foreign IP?
From a security standpoint it's workable: VLESS+Reality uses a dedicated foreign node that disguises your traffic as ordinary HTTPS. Worth noting: when you first sign in from a new foreign IP, LinkedIn may trigger an extra identity check (email / SMS) — that's its normal risk control, not a sign of a block; just complete the verification.
